I can attest there the boulders DO have homing capabilities. I had one overshoot me, then loop back around. Most other times when I step aside, they will actually curve their trajectory to hit me. The most egregious example was not two hours ago, I was heading north from Fort Hagen to Sanctuary to stock up, and I had Ada with me. It was really foggy, and midday. As I neared that place with the cars stacked on each other like an automotive Stonehenge, I heard the characteristic thudding, indicating a Behemoth was nearby. Since I couldn't see through the fog, I activated VATS, and found it. I took a shot to get its attention, then backed off under Caution. It spotted Ada and threw a boulder. Since she was standing near some large rocks, the boulder actually CURVED toward her at first. However, due to the rocks, it couldn't hit her directly at first, so it literally HOVERED in midair over her head, jittering back and forth while moving downward, like it was working its way into the hitboxes. Then it dropped and hit her.

Behemoths use aimbots.
